<title>Research on the influence of dilution media on ram sperm cryopreservation</title>
<link>https://repository.utm.md/handle/5014/36672</link>
<description>Research on the influence of dilution media on ram sperm cryopreservation
CIBOTARU, Elena; DARIE, Grigore; DJENJERA, Irina; CHISALITA, Oleg
In the study, ram sperm from the Moldovan Karakul breed bred in the experimental section of the Scientific Institute of Biotechnology Practices in Animal Husbandry and Veterinary Medicine. Ejaculates with a mobility of no less than 70% and a concentration of 2.0 billion/ml were admitted for processing. For dilution, GTJ, STJ and STJ+ dilution media were used, in which the biologically active preparation extracted from cyanobacteria&#13;
at the Institute of Microbiology and Biotechnology of the Technical University of Moldova was introduced as an additional component. After resuscitation, the mobility, rectilinear movements of the spermatozoa, acrosome integrity were studied. The experimental results showed that the STJ+ dilution medium in which the biologically active preparation extracted from the cyanobacteria was introduced gave the possibility to obtain after thawing the mobility of 49.2+1.7, spermatozoa with rectilinear movements VAP – 105.5+2 ,7, VSL-91.5+4.5, VCL-170.7+8.5, sperm abnormalities -14.5%, acrosome integrity 24.4+0.4 compared to the other GTS and STJ dilution media, which gave us the possibility to recommend for the cryopreservation of ram sperm the STJ+ medium in which the biologically active preparation was introduced as an additional component in a concentration of 0.4-0.7% for the cryopreservation of ram sperm.

<title>The role of the biologically active preparation in optimizing spermatogenesis in breeding boars</title>
<link>https://repository.utm.md/handle/5014/36671</link>
<description>The role of the biologically active preparation in optimizing spermatogenesis in breeding boars
CIBOTARU, Elena; DARIE, Grigore; DJENJERA, Irina; ROTARI, S.
The study aimed to evaluate the role of a complex biologically active preparation in optimizing spermatogenesis in breeding boars. The results showed an increase in ejaculate volume in the experimental group (202.5 ± 29.5 ml compared to 168.0 ± 8.5 ml in the control group), as well as an improvement in the qualitative parameters of the semen. Specifically, the percentage of motile spermatozoa increased to 92.4 ± 0.4% compared to 92.0 ± 0.4% in the control group. Additionally, a significant increase in the percentage of progressively motile spermatozoa was observed (72.3 ± 2.8% in the experimental group versus 65.3 ± 2.9% in the control group). Furthermore, the proportion of morphologically normal spermatozoa was higher in the experimental group (78.3 ± 2.9%) than in the&#13;
control group (69.8 ± 3.4%). Thus, the administration of the complex biologically active preparation optimized the spermatogenesis process in breeding boars by increasing ejaculate volume and improving qualitative parameters (motility, progressive motility, and normal morphology), indicating its potential benefit in supporting reproductive capacity.

<title>Research on ram sperm freezing</title>
<link>https://repository.utm.md/handle/5014/36669</link>
<description>Research on ram sperm freezing
CIBOTARU, Elena; BRADU, Nina; ROTARI, Doina; DARIE, Grigore; DJENJERA, Irina
The aim of the research was to perfect the ram sperm freezing protocols and develop the dilution medium for cryopreservation. The research was carried out on ram sperm, collected with the help of the artificial vagina. Ejaculates with a mobility of no less than 70% and a concentration of spermatozoa in the ejaculate of 2.5 billion/ml were taken for processing. Dilution medium consisting of sucrose, sodium citrate and egg yolk was used to dilute the semen. As an additional component in the composition of the environment, the preparation MP was introduced in a concentration from 0.1 to 1.0%/v. Post-thaw motility, spermatozoa with rectilinear movements, spermatozoa abnormalities, and spermatozoa with damaged acrosome were assessed. The results of the research demonstrated that the introduction in the dilution medium of the MP preparation in a concentration of 0.5-0.7% as an additional component allowed the mobility to be maintained at the level of 57% and the number of spermatozoa with rectilinear movements of 26-27 % after thawing, or 3.8% higher compared to the control group after thawing, it also allowed to decrease the percentage of spermatozoa with abnormalities by 2.9% and spermatozoa with damaged acrosome by 2%.
